| Santería | Santería is an Afro-Cuban religion that blends elements of Catholicism with traditional Yoruba beliefs. It is primarily practiced in Cuba and among the Cuban diaspora. Also known as Regla de Ocha, Santería is a syncretic religion that emerged in Cuba among African slaves. It associates orishas, Yoruba deities, with corresponding Catholic saints. Religious practices include offerings, dances, songs, and complex initiations. Santería emphasizes a personal connection with the orishas, who guide and protect their followers through divinatory consultations. |
